Sourcing guidance for Circuit Breaker Siemens
What are the key technical specifications to verify when sourcing Siemens circuit breakers?
Buyers must prioritize the Rated Current (In), Rated Voltage (Un), and Breaking Capacity (Icu/Ics). For industrial applications, ensure the breaking capacity meets the short-circuit levels of your power system (e.g., 10kA, 25kA, or 65kA). Additionally, confirm the Tripping Characteristic (Type B, C, or D) to ensure compatibility with the specific load type, such as resistive loads or high-inrush motor starts.
Which international compliance standards should these products adhere to?
Siemens circuit breakers must comply with IEC 60947-2 for industrial use or IEC 60898-1 for residential applications. For North American markets, UL 489 or UL 1077 certification is mandatory. Ensure the products carry the CE mark for European markets and CCC certification if the destination is China. Always request a Certificate of Compliance (CoC) from the supplier.
How can I distinguish between genuine Siemens products and counterfeits in a B2B transaction?
Verify the 3D security seal and the unique serial number on the product packaging. Genuine Siemens breakers feature high-quality laser-engraved markings rather than ink-printed labels. You should also check the QR code using the Siemens Industry Online Support (SIOS) app. Sourcing from Authorized Economic Operators (AEO) or verified gold suppliers on Made-in-China.com significantly reduces the risk of receiving fraudulent goods.
What environmental and durability factors are critical for long-term performance?
Check the IP Rating (e.g., IP20 for standard DIN rail units) to ensure protection against solid objects. For harsh environments, verify the Operating Temperature Range (typically -25°C to +70°C) and Pollution Degree. High-quality Siemens units utilize silver-alloy contacts to minimize electrical resistance and heat generation, extending the mechanical life to over 20,000 switching cycles.
Cross-Border Procurement & Risk Management for Electrical Components
What are the primary risks when purchasing high-value electrical components cross-border?
The main risks include counterfeit products, incompatible voltage standards, and damage during transit. To mitigate these, use Trade Assurance services provided by platforms like Made-in-China.com to secure your payment until the goods are verified. Always insist on Pre-Shipment Inspection (PSI) by third parties like SGS or Intertek to confirm technical specs before the balance payment.
How should I negotiate pricing and lead times with suppliers?
For Siemens components, pricing is often tied to volume tiers. Aim for a 15-20% discount on orders exceeding 500 units. Regarding lead times, standard MCBs usually have a 7-14 day lead time, but specialized MCCBs or ACB units may take 4-8 weeks. Negotiate a penalty clause for late delivery (e.g., 1% reduction per week of delay) to ensure project timelines are met.
What are the best practices for shipping sensitive electrical equipment to international destinations?
Ensure the supplier uses anti-static packaging and moisture-proof vacuum sealing. For sea freight, products should be packed in fumigated wooden crates with shock-absorption materials. Specify Incoterms 2020 clearly; CIF (Cost, Insurance, and Freight) is recommended for new buyers to ensure the seller covers insurance, while FOB (Free On Board) offers more control over logistics costs for experienced importers.
How do I ensure compliance with international trade policies and customs?
Verify the HS Code (typically 8536.20) to calculate accurate import duties and taxes. Ensure the supplier provides a Commercial Invoice, Packing List, and Bill of Lading that match the technical descriptions exactly. Be aware of anti-dumping duties or specific trade sanctions that may apply to electrical switchgear in your region to avoid customs seizures.
